High Density Aluminum Skived Fin Heat Sink
High density skived fin heatsinks are manufactured by a cutting tool to bend the fins with a certain angle,high density skived fin heatsinks has much more surface area which has a much better thermal transferring ability.The skived fin heatsink can be used to cool down the high power equipment. This process can increase 8~15% of cooling capacity compared to the bonding fin process.
Product Introduction
Aluminium Skived Fin heatsinks can be an alternative to extruded heat sinks when looking for fin density parts which can’t be made by extrusion technology, or can be the alternative to fin-brazing or fin-bonding parts as well to achieve high performance.
Aluminium Skived Fins are made by using series of knives that literally shaves fins up from extruded aluminum base. The process of slicing and standing fins up at a time can create an extremely high fin-gap aspect ratio, then the top of fins will be cut to a uniform height.
A skived fin heat sink offers maximum thermal performance in a given space, compared with other manufacturing process, skiving technique offers thinner fins, denser fin pitch and high aspect ratio which provides more heat dissipation area, and due to the skived fins are sliced from the base, so the thermal resistance between the fin and base is very low, which makes the heat sink has great thermal conductivity. The thermal conductivity of copper is ~400W/m-k, which is best conductor of heat in all the commercial metals, so a copper skived fin heat sink can remove the heat from the CPU rapidly and dissipate to the air quickly. it is a great thermal solution for CPUs and other electronic components.
